Accounting watchdog launches inquiry into Tesco
Tesco said in September that it had overstated first-half profits by £250m (€319m) due to incorrectly booking payments from suppliers — a figure later raised to £263m, compounding earlier profit warnings.
The scandal led to the suspension, then exit, of several senior executives and sparked a series of investigations — including by Britain’s Serious Fraud Office — and possible investor lawsuits both in Britain and the US.
